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
042029 4790331156 582183 4445
14435732 6722750
14435732 6722750
5158 21669549450 66072874145
All about undefined
Interested in learning more?
14435732 6722750
5158 21669549450 66072874145
See more
1880192 856
23163 078 731936886 4048065
See more
6324300 68100 6011809
8599410083 4904429 01410
See more